To ensure a smooth and efficient notarization, please have the following ready:
Government-issued identification such as a driver's license, passport, or state ID card. Must be current and not expired.
Every person who needs to sign the document must be physically present at the time of notarization. No exceptions.
Do not sign your documents ahead of time unless specifically instructed. Signing must occur in the notary's presence.
Some documents require witnesses. Check your document requirements and arrange for witnesses if applicable.
If any of these requirements are not met, we may be unable to proceed with the notarization. Please prepare accordingly to avoid delays or rescheduling.
To protect all parties and comply with Utah notary law:
We do not provide legal advice or draft documents
We cannot advise which notarial act is required
We cannot notarize incomplete or improperly prepared documents
All notarizations are performed in compliance with Utah law
Our role is strictly limited to performing the notarial act and witnessing signatures according to Utah state regulations.
